]> ToastFreeware Gitweb - chrisu/seepark.git/blobdiff - web/seepark_web.py
pass timespan (in days) to our /data route via GET
[chrisu/seepark.git] / web / seepark_web.py
index 0a1aa34a7f502fa28e4eb73dde60074dc173daa0..fa08f12480bf96d5a6ace7283fdf1b579efd1b7c 100644 (file)
@@ -3,11 +3,11 @@ from random import uniform
 import time
 app = Flask(__name__)
 
-@app.route("/data")
-def data():
+@app.route('/data/', defaults={'timespan': 1})
+@app.route("/data/<int:timespan>", methods=['GET'])
+def data(timespan):
 
-    timespan = 1                             # days
-    granularity = 5 * timespan               # (every) minute(s)
+    granularity = 5 * timespan               # (every) minute(s) per day
     samples = 60/granularity * 24 * timespan # per hour over whole timespan
     s4m   = []
     s4m_x = []